Output cf61ca666b6cedf213860a78c07f757f5b990cdaed564fdf31f47ff175334ada:8
- value
- 11466926
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f843a046c4a4cc72434723cafe0d7e071e3d2d6e OP_EQUAL
- address
- 3QKiWrqdNHdTCLCR8R2YU5i17Ke2YdXKsF
- transaction
- cf61ca666b6cedf213860a78c07f757f5b990cdaed564fdf31f47ff175334ada
- spent
- true